Khabar Arkhi (Persian: خبرارخي)[a] is a village in Ali Sadr Rural District[3] of Gol Tappeh District in Kabudarahang County, Hamadan province, Iran.

Demographics

[edit]

Population

[edit]

At the time of the 2006 National Census, the village's population was 949 in 188 households.[4] The following census in 2011 counted 882 people in 249 households.[5] The 2016 census measured the population of the village as 896 people in 243 households.[1]
